- First MS-Nurse Anesthesia, MS-Clinical Nurse Leader, Post-Graduate Teaching Certificate, PhD, and DNP programs in Maryland
- First graduate programs in nursing informatics in the world
- First and only Environmental Health Education Center graduate certificate program in the nation
- First online RN/BSN; Trauma/Critical Care MS; and Health Policy MS programs in the nation
- 24 Clinical Simulation Labs, one of the largest in the nation and a regional resource
- Demographics: Minority students make up 37 percent of UMSON’s population, while male students make up 12 percent
- Graduates more than 200 new nurses annually
- NCLEX Pass Rate: BSN graduates – 91 percent; CNL graduates – 93 percent
- Alumni from 50 states and 19 countries
- Educates more than 40 percent of Maryland’s nurses
- Nearly 18,000 living alumni
- 134 faculty members (full- and part-time): 65 percent doctoral-prepared; 35 percent master’s prepared
- 33 unique Web-based courses with 68 total sections
- Ranked 11th in the nation among schools with graduate nursing programs; four master's specialties ranked in the top 10
- Ranked 19th in research funding from the National Institutes of Health National Institute of Nursing Research
